Hidden Word (“the App”) is provided by Webspring (“we”, “us”). This policy describes what the App does and does not collect.
Hidden Word is a personal Scripture rehearsal app. We do not require accounts, and we do not sell personal data.
Information the App uses
- Passage requests. When you load a passage, the App sends the reference you enter to our server proxy, which retrieves ESV text and audio from Crossway’s API. We use this only to fulfill your request.
- On-device preferences. Settings such as My list, recents, Schedule, Timer, and playback preferences may be stored on your device. Cached audio may also be stored so verses can keep playing reliably.
- Notifications. If you enable Schedule or Timer, the App uses system notification capabilities you grant. You can revoke these in iOS Settings.
What we do not do
- We do not create user accounts or login profiles for the App.
- We do not sell your data to third parties.
- We do not use advertising trackers or analytics SDKs in the App for ad targeting.
Third parties
- Crossway / ESV API — provides Scripture text and audio for the references you request. Their terms apply to API use.
- Hosting — our proxy and this support site may be hosted on Cloudflare. Standard server logs (e.g. IP, time, URL) may be collected by the host for security and reliability.
- Apple — if you download via the App Store or TestFlight, Apple’s privacy practices apply to distribution.
